7. Tackling The Biggest Little Man - 11.12.03

Big bully Lesnar was one a roll in late 2003, completely dismantling much smaller opponents on a regular basis. The likes of Zach Gowen, Brian Kendrick, Paul London and Shannon Moore all felt the wrath of Lesnar, with one-legged wonder Gowen coming in for some particularly harsh treatment. One so-called 'little man' who could provide Lesnar with some competition was Rey Mysterio and the two clashed on December 11th.

Adding to the occasion was the fact that the match was taking place in Mysterio's hometown of San Diego, California. This was your classic big man/little man match, with Rey getting swatted away and overpowered and having to use his quickness and intelligence to get any sort of advantage on his massively muscled opponent.

Lesnar let Rey get a lot of his offense in, including a beautiful springboard dive to the outside of the ring, but he eventually seized control of the match and wore the maser of the 619 down. Brock dominated, with Rey's wife and kids looking on from the front row, squeezing the life out of him with a bodyscissors.

Rey fought back like the great babyface that he is and rocked Brock with a ringpost 619 and a springboard leg drop. Unfortunately, it wasn't enough to secure the victory, and Lesnar came back with a vicious powerbomb and a vicious powerbomb and the Brock Lock for the submission win.

It wasn't a flawless match by any means, but it was heated and competitive and exciting and one of the more notable Smackdown matches from Lesnar's back catalogue.
